Slow Cooker Apple-Cranberry Crepes

ingredients
  nonstick cooking spray
1 large baking apple, such as Gala or Jonathan, peeled, halved and cored
1 large tart apple, such as Granny Smith, peeled, halved and cored
1/4 cup dried sweetened cranberries or cherries
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g
1/2 teaspoon ground cloves or allspice
1 tablespoon margarine
1/4 cup orange juice
1 tablespoon sugar
1/4 teaspoon almond extract
1/4 teaspoon cornstarch
4  prepared crepes
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1 cup vanilla ice cream (optional)
directions
Coat a slow cooker with cooking spray. 
 Cut each apple half into 3 wedges. Place apple wedges, cranberries, lemon juice, 1/2 teaspoon of the cinnamon, nutmeg, and allspice in slow cooker, and toss to coat. Cover and cook on LOW for 2 hours. 
 Add margarine to apple mixture and toss until just melted. 
 Combine orange juice, sugar substitute, almond extract and cornstarch in a small bowl. Stir until cornstarch dissolves. Add mixture to apples, stirring to blend. Cover and cook on HIGH for 15 minutes to thicken sauce slightly. 
 Place a crepe on each individual dessert plate. Spoon equal amounts of the apple mixture down the center of each crepe. Fold edges over and turn crepes over with seam side down on plate. Sprinkle with the remaining cinnamon. 
 Heat filled crepes in microwave, if desired, according to directions on package. 
 Spoon equal amounts of the ice cream, if using, alongside each serving.
